Art (Grades 2-4) 12 More spaces available! Register today! Students will spend time refining their drawing, painting, sculpting, and collaging skills through mixed media art. Students will also have the opportunity to give constructive criticism through critiques to help their classmates improve their projects as well as learn how to receive feedback. Students will focus on 1-2 projects for the first 2nd quarter session. At the end of our programming calendar parents will be invited to a Parent Share Night where students will share with you all of the projects they have been working on and what they have learned.

Boys’ Mentoring (Grades 3-4 by invitation) Closed. No more spaces available. Boys to Men will focus on teamwork and respecting skills in a mentoring program. This program will last 10 weeks, meeting on Mondays and Wednesdays from 4:15-5:15pm in Room 311. The themes will include: growing healthy, going strong, and a journey into respect. The boys will identify social-emotional messages, attitudes and smart options for growing up as a male in our culture.

Girls’ Circle (Grades 3-4 by invitation) Closed. No more spaces available. Girls’ Circle will focus on developing friendship skills in a mentoring program. This program will last 10 weeks, meeting on Mondays and Wednesdays from 4:15-5:15pm in Room 314. The themes will include: Being my own friend first; Being included, Being left out; and Feuds, followers and fairness. The girls will identify social-emotional messages, attitudes and smart options for growing up as a female in our culture.

Rev-Up Your Reading (Grades 1-2) In this after school reading club, first and second grade scholars will practice grade- level reading skills using exciting games and activities. There will be a large focus on mastering grade level sight words through activities such as BINGO and Spelling Bees. Scholars will leave the program feeling more confident and inspired to read!

Drama & Dance (Grades 1-4) Scholars will audition, rehearse, and perform a musical production of Cinderella. Scholars will read, view, and discuss multicultural versions of this classic fairy tale.

Youth Dance Troupe (Grades 1-4) Rehearsals for 7YDT will take place on Thursdays from 4:00-5:15. Through a 2 session 9 week dance program, students will learn 360 degrees of dance including the art of Hip- Hop, lyrical, ballet, modern, African, tap, salsa, and cheer. At the end of each 9 week session Learn 7 will present a dance recital showcasing all skills learned through the 9 weeks.
